About
Genius Annotation
“Don’t Let the Sun Go Down on Me” is a song written by Elton John and his lyricist Bernie Taupin. The song was originally recorded in 1974 by Elton John for his studio album, Caribou. The song was a hit in the US, peaking at #2 on the Billboard Hot 100.
